#86d696 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#86d696 is composed of 52.5% red, 83.9%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 132 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 68.2%. #86d696 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0dad2d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#86d696 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#86d696 has RGB values of R:134, G:214,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 8836758.

Hex triplet 86d696 #86d696
RGB Decimal 134, 214, 150 rgb(134,214,150)
RGB Percent 52.5, 83.9, 58.8 rgb(52.5%,83.9%,58.8%)
CMYK 37, 0, 30, 16
HSL 132°, 49.4, 68.2 hsl(132,49.4%,68.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 132°, 37.4, 83.9
Web Safe 99cc99 #99cc99
CIE-LAB 79.249, -37.804, 24.077
XYZ 39.381, 55.362, 37.463
xyY 0.298, 0.419, 55.362
CIE-LCH 79.249, 44.82, 147.507
CIE-LUV 79.249, -38.592, 40.128
Hunter-Lab 74.405, -35.733, 22.231
Binary 10000110, 11010110, 10010110

Shades and Tints of #86d696

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b05 is the darkest color, while #fbfefc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#86d696 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b7b7b7 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#adbdb0 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d5c794 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e6c0a3 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#9ccfde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b8cc94 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c3c89e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#94d1c4 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
